General Statement
The Museum of the Rockies’ Early Childhood Coordinator is responsible for achieving and maintaining excellence in museum programming for children and family audiences.
They design and implement a variety of programs focused on : early childhood classes; the Martin Children’s Discovery Center exhibit;
and other activities for families. Under the direction of the Director of Education and Public Programs and in collaboration with other staff members, the Early Childhood Coordinator will develop and oversee the museum’s early learning programs, fostering curiosity and engagement for the museum’s youngest visitors and their families.
The Early Childhood Coordinator facilitates early educational programs for children ages 0-5 and their caregivers, including our weekly Sensational Babies, Little Learners, and Preschool Pioneers classes.
Utilizing multisensory and developmentally appropriate methods for these programs, the Early Childhood Coordinator facilitates learning experiences that focus on MOR content related to cultural history, natural history, and astronomy, engaging this age group with accurate content and meeting best practices in informal education.
